Understanding the Causes of Snapped Car Keys


Before diving into options, it's necessary to comprehend why car keys snap in the first location. Here are a few typical causes:

  1. Wear and Tear: Over time, keys can become brittle due to metal tiredness. Utilizing an old key consistently can eventually cause its breaking.

  2. Extreme Force: Applying excessive pressure when placing or turning the key can cause it to snap.

  3. Ecological Factors: Extreme temperatures— both hot and cold— can damage the metal in a car key, resulting in breakage.

  4. Production Flaws: In some cases, keys may have intrinsic weak points due to faults in manufacturing.

What to Do When Your Key Snaps


If you find yourself in the regrettable circumstance where your car key has actually snapped, here's what to do:

Step-by-Step Action Plan

  1. Examine the Situation: Determine if part of the key is still in the lock or ignition. If any fragment is stuck, avoid attempting to remove it yourself to avoid further damage.

  2. Call a Locksmith: Contact an expert locksmith in Luton who focuses on automotive keys. Offer information about your vehicle make and design, as it may impact the kind of key required.

  3. Usage Spare Key: If you have a spare key, utilize it until the broken key is replaced. It's an excellent practice to keep a spare handy to reduce hassle.

  4. Consider a Dealership: If your vehicle requires a specific key type, especially those with transponder chips, connecting to your dealer may be the best choice. They can provide a replacement key, although often at a higher expense.

  5. Emergency Services: If you're stranded and can not access your car, contact emergency locksmith services in Luton. Numerous deal 24-hour help.

Preventing Future Incidents


To prevent the tension of a snapped type in the future, think about carrying out the following preventive steps:

  1. Routine Key Inspection: Regularly check your keys for indications of wear and tear, and change them when necessary.

  2. Key Maintenance: Keep your keys tidy and devoid of dirt. Avoid exposing them to severe conditions.

  3. Appropriate Handling: Use your key gently. Prevent using extreme force when turning or placing it.

  4. Professional Help: When you discover any problems, such as difficulty turning the key, seek advice from a locksmith before it becomes a bigger problem.

  5. Shop Keys Strategically: Always keep your type in a safe place, far from areas where they might get damaged or lost.

Often Asked Questions


Q: Can I drive my car with a broken key?

A: It often depends upon where the key has actually snapped. If the staying piece is still in the ignition, do not attempt to begin the vehicle. It's best to contact a locksmith.

Q: How much does it cost to replace a snapped car key in Luton?

A: The cost can differ depending upon the key type and the locksmith's rates. Normally, a replacement can range from ₤ 70 to ₤ 250.
